Abstract

The article using social-philosophical anticipation, as a logically constructed model of a possible future with a certain confidence level, determining characteristics of the immediate future of religious culture, justifying the application of the basic forecasting principles: objectivity, historicity and development etc. The sources of social forecasting perform systematic public information, which characterizes the development of religious culture. The essence of the religious culture is defined as the human awareness of connection real earthly and the divine world, which is unknown, but very desirable, analyzes the conditions that affect the future of religious culture. The religious culture of the future is determined by trends of liberalization religious doctrines of church organizations and the development stabilization of non-traditional religiosity. The attention of the society again concentrating on the traditional and world religions, but not solved old and new church problems, reducing the quality of traditional religiosity, determines the religious culture as a basis of public contemporary processes.
